Who Pays the Most Cash for Junk Cars in Las Vegas?
No single buyer pays the most for junk cars in Las Vegas. The highest offer depends on what your car is worth to that specific type of buyer. Across 1,847 completed valley sales, scrap-only vehicles went to tow-buyers and scrap yards, older cars with reusable parts to salvage yards and auto recyclers, and running vehicles to full-service yards and used car dealers. The spread between the highest and lowest number quoted on the same car averaged $212.
So the real question isn’t which company pays the most. It’s which kind of buyer your car belongs to. Here’s how that breaks down.
| If your car is… | Best type of buyer | Why they pay more | Typical Vegas range |
|---|---|---|---|
| Stripped or burned shell No converter, no drivetrain, or fire damage | Scrap yard or tow-buyer | Priced on metal weight. Independent tow operators flip these to recyclers all day and win on low overhead, not on parts. | $180–$390 214 sales |
| Older car with good parts 2000–2012, complete, non-running | Salvage yard, recycler or parts yard | They resell the alternator, doors, glass, and wheels individually, so a complete car is worth far more to them than its scrap weight. | $425–$880 631 sales |
| Late-model wreck 2013+, collision or insurance total | Full-service salvage buyer | Engines, transmissions, and modules resell for real money. This is where offers most often clear four figures. | $1,100–$3,400 288 sales |
| Still drives, not worth fixing High mileage, failed emissions, cosmetic damage | Used car dealer or private buyer | Someone will drive it as-is, which beats any dismantler. Junking a running car is usually the most expensive mistake on this page. | $1,600–$4,200 173 sales |
| Truck, SUV or van, any condition Heavier curb weight | Any of the above, get all four | More metal plus in-demand parts means the buyer types converge. This is the category where competition changes the number most. | $540–$1,950 541 sales |
Ranges reflect completed Las Vegas sales in the last 90 days and are not quotes. Identify your car’s category first, then talk to the buyer types that fit it.

How to Sell a Junk Car for Cash in Las Vegas
The sequence is the same whichever buyer you use. Describe the car accurately, gather more than one number, compare what you net after towing, sign the title over, and take payment before the car leaves.
Year, make, model, mileage, what runs, what’s missing. Surprises on site are what get offers cut in the driveway.
Never work from a single quote. The spread on the same Las Vegas car averages $212.
A $400 offer with free pickup beats a $525 offer that costs you a $150 tow.
Title signed over, bill of sale for your records, plates off before the truck leaves.
Cash or transfer confirmed before the car is loaded, then cancel the insurance.
Before the truck arrives: have your title and photo ID ready, remove the plates, take out your belongings, and don’t cancel insurance until the car is gone.
Free Junk Car Removal in Las Vegas
This is the biggest practical difference between the two kinds of business on this page. A self-service junkyard generally expects you to deliver the vehicle. A junk car buyer comes to you and the tow is inside the offer, which is why a $400 offer with free pickup beats a $525 offer that costs you a $150 tow.
Do junk car buyers charge for towing?
Dedicated buyers build towing into the offer. Yards that tow as a courtesy sometimes deduct $75–$150, especially outside the beltway, so always ask for the net number.
How fast can a junk car be picked up?
Median time from listing to pickup in the valley is about six hours. Two to four hours is achievable if you list before noon; yards that schedule tows around other work run one to four days.
Can you remove a car that doesn’t run?
Yes, most junk cars don’t run. Flat tires, no keys, and a seized engine are routine. Flag tight access, alleys, or a gated car when you list it.
Can you pick up from a tow yard or repair shop?
Usually, with a release authorization from that facility and your ownership documents. Storage fees owed there come out of your proceeds, so settle that first.
Can You Sell a Junk Car Without a Title in Las Vegas?
Yes, in most cases. Cash For Junk Cars Las Vegas handles registration-and-ID purchases routinely, and no-title cars cost sellers $118 on average in our Las Vegas data. Be careful to separate what a buyer will accept as its own policy from what the Nevada DMV requires to transfer ownership.
A $60 duplicate title usually pays for itself twice over. Always remove your plates.

Do junkyards pay cash for cars?
Many do, though larger and corporate operations increasingly pay by check or electronic transfer. Confirm the payment method and timing before you accept an offer.
Will a junkyard pick up my car for free?
Dedicated junk car buyers almost always include towing. Self-service yards often expect you to deliver the vehicle, and some yards deduct the tow from your offer, so ask for the net amount you’ll be handed.
Can I sell a car that doesn’t run?
Yes. Most junk cars don’t run, and on older vehicles it barely affects value. It matters more on newer cars where the engine and transmission carry the offer.
Can I sell a totaled car for cash?
Yes, and totaled late-model vehicles are often the highest-value cars in this market because their undamaged parts are in demand. Salvage buyers usually pay the most for these.
How quickly can I have my junk car removed?
Same-day removal is realistic with a dedicated buyer if you call in the morning. Yards that tow as a side service typically schedule one to four days out.
What paperwork do I need to junk a car in Nevada?
Generally the title signed over to the buyer, your photo ID, and a bill of sale. Remove your license plates and cancel insurance after pickup. Keep a copy of the bill of sale.
Should I sell my car to a junkyard or a junk car buyer?
A junk car buyer if you want speed, free towing, and cash. A junkyard if you can deliver the car and want to deal with the recycler directly. If the vehicle still drives and is worth repairing, a private sale or dealer usually beats both.
